Regular Life-span of Exterior Paint



When it involves the typical life-span of exterior paint, several factors enter into play, including environment, surface prep work, and paint top quality.

Usually, you can expect business exterior paint to last anywhere from five to ten years. Nonetheless, this timeline can move substantially based on where you live. In harsher climates with severe temperature levels or high humidity, you may find your paint degrading faster.

Surface area preparation is vital, also. If you don't appropriately clean and prime the surface area prior to paint, the paint will not stick well, causing early peeling and fading.

You should also take into consideration the kind of paint you pick. Higher-quality paints normally include better pigments and resins, which can boost longevity and prolong the life-span.

Last but not least, the place of your building plays a role. Areas that get direct sunlight may experience quicker fading than those that are shaded.

If you take these variables right into account and select your materials intelligently, you can optimize the long life of your outside paint. Routine maintenance, like washing the surface and evaluating for damages, can also help you obtain one of the most out of your paint financial investment.

Indicators It's Time to Paint



Recognizing when to paint your industrial outside can save you time and money over time. You should try to find specific signs that suggest it's time to do something about it.

First, look for peeling or breaking paint. If you see huge areas where the paint has begun to find off, it's a clear indication that your exterior needs interest.

Next, seek fading or discoloration. If your building appears plain or irregular in color, it might be time for a fresh layer. Additionally, if you notice mold and mildew or mold externally, do not ignore it. These problems can jeopardize the integrity of the paint and the surface underneath.

Watch out for liquid chalking, which happens when paint starts to break down right into a chalky deposit. This can suggest that the paint is failing.



Last but not least, think about the age of your paint. If it's been five to 7 years given that your last repaint, you may wish to analyze its condition a lot more closely.

Resolving these indications immediately will help keep your commercial residential property's appearance and secure it from further damage.
